The Spanish rice market is expected to register a CAGR of 2.1% during the forecast period. Spain is the second-largest producer of rice in Europe, with 25-30% of total European production. The major rice-producing areas in the country are Andalucía, Extremadura, Cataluña, Comunidad Valencia, Aragón, and Navarra.

WebbA special role in this success story appears to be played by one characteristic of Spain’s swine sector: the high degree of vertical integration. Some 65% of all pig meat is produced from the integrated chain. Cooperative societies supply a further 18%, with just a little more than 15% of slaughter pig production by »free« farmers producing ... WebbSpain has more than 29 million acres (11.7 million hectares) under permanent crops, the largest such area in Europe. About 6 percent of Spain’s workers are employed in agriculture, and they produce about 3 percent of the county’s GDP. On Iberianature.
